Oneroa Village Oasis - Central Near Beaches
Summary:
Oneroa Village Oasis is a newly renovated three-bedroom home set just above Oneroa Village, surrounded by native bush with light ocean glimpses. Quietly positioned yet centrally located, it offers an easy base within walking distance of beaches, cafés, shops, and village life.

The Neighborhood:
Oneroa Village Oasis is located just above Oneroa Village, the island’s main hub for cafés, restaurants, galleries, and shops. Oneroa Beach, Little Oneroa Beach, and Blackpool Beach are all close by and popular for swimming, walking, and relaxed days by the water.
The coastal walk from Little Oneroa offers scenic views and picnic spots, while the village itself provides plenty of options for dining and entertainment. Nearby favourites include The Oyster Inn and Fenice for evening meals, along with casual daytime options throughout the village. The Waiheke Community Art Gallery and Waiheke Island Community Cinema are also within walking distance and add to the area’s local character.
Getting Around:
The closest bus stops are located in Oneroa Village, within easy walking distance of the property. Regular bus services run through Oneroa and connect to beaches, vineyards, and the passenger ferry terminal. Buses also continue to Onetangi, stopping near major wineries, before returning to Oneroa and the ferry.
On-site parking is available. Taxis, e-bikes, scooters, and rental cars operate across Waiheke, though availability can be limited during peak periods.
Other Things to Note:
Minimum stays apply as follows: seven nights from mid December to mid February and during most of April, three nights on all holiday weekends, and two nights at all other times.
The home uses rainwater tanks, which is common on Waiheke. Mindful water use is appreciated throughout your stay.
